Before the Board’s Regular business meeting begins Mr. Elefante (invited by the Board) discussed the advantages and ramifications of changing the Bylaws and Declaration of Brookridge from a Homeowner’s Association to a Condominium. (He had just completed a similar change for Fairway Green in Mamaroneck that resulted in a tax reduction in the range of 25%-40%.) Mr. Elefante stated that his review of Brookridge’s Bylaws and Declaration found nothing to prevent us from a similar conversion.

The Board voted unanimously to retain Mr.Elefante to address Brookridge homeowners at an informational meeting (to be held in October). Mr. Elefante will be present at this meeting to explain the advantages and process of conversion, additional meetings will follow. Please Note: Two thirds of all homeowners must vote in favor of conversion before any action can be taken.
